Gross fixed capital formation, Private sector, Current prices in Sri Lanka
Sri Lanka: Gross fixed capital formation, Private sector, Current prices was 3,284 in 2019. ◆ Volatile
Gross fixed capital formation, Private sector, Current prices in Sri Lanka, 1970–2019
Source: International Monetary Fund.
Analysis
Sri Lanka recorded 3,284 for gross fixed capital formation, private sector, current prices in 2019. That is the highest value across all 50 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.9% on the previous year and up 259.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ross fixed capital formation, private sector, current prices in Sri Lanka peaked at 3,284 in 2019 and was at its lowest, 1.84, in 1971.
Sri Lanka ranks 39th of 174 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Gross fixed capital formation, Private sector, Current prices in Sri Lanka,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1970 | 1.92 | — |
| 1971 | 1.84 | -4.2% |
| 1972 | 2.01 | +9.6% |
| 1973 | 2.22 | +10.4% |
| 1974 | 2.3 | +3.4% |
| 1975 | 2.64 | +15.1% |
| 1976 | 3.06 | +15.8% |
| 1977 | 3.35 | +9.6% |
| 1978 | 6.84 | +104.0% |
| 1979 | 11.42 | +66.8% |
| 1980 | 18.87 | +65.3% |
| 1981 | 21.42 | +13.5% |
| 1982 | 25.4 | +18.6% |
| 1983 | 28.49 | +12.2% |
| 1984 | 30.58 | +7.3% |
| 1985 | 32.79 | +7.2% |
| 1986 | 32.6 | -0.6% |
| 1987 | 36.5 | +12.0% |
| 1988 | 39.24 | +7.5% |
| 1989 | 41.44 | +5.6% |
| 1990 | 57.93 | +39.8% |
| 1991 | 76.41 | +31.9% |
| 1992 | 90.19 | +18.0% |
| 1993 | 109.6 | +21.5% |
| 1994 | 139.29 | +27.1% |
| 1995 | 156.84 | +12.6% |
| 1996 | 186.49 | +18.9% |
| 1997 | 213.01 | +14.2% |
| 1998 | 242.49 | +13.8% |
| 1999 | 268.81 | +10.9% |
| 2000 | 300.13 | +11.7% |
| 2001 | 274.93 | -8.4% |
| 2002 | 308.1 | +12.1% |
| 2003 | 340.42 | +10.5% |
| 2004 | 449.37 | +32.0% |
| 2005 | 513.95 | +14.4% |
| 2006 | 668.84 | +30.1% |
| 2007 | 769.39 | +15.0% |
| 2008 | 924.34 | +20.1% |
| 2009 | 913.47 | -1.2% |
| 2010 | 1,216 | +33.1% |
| 2011 | 1,600 | +31.6% |
| 2012 | 2,172 | +35.8% |
| 2013 | 2,427 | +11.7% |
| 2014 | 2,383 | -1.8% |
| 2015 | 2,317 | -2.8% |
| 2016 | 2,706 | +16.8% |
| 2017 | 2,981 | +10.2% |
| 2018 | 3,160 | +6.0% |
| 2019 | 3,284 | +3.9% |
